-cesine
Turkish
Etymology
Inherited from Ottoman Turkish ـجهسنه (-casına, -cesine).
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/dʒe.si.ne/
Suffix
| preceding vowel | ||
|---|---|---|
| a / ı / o / u | e / i / ö / ü | |
| default | -casına | -cesine |
| assimilated | -çasına | -çesine |
-cesine
- as if
- Synonym: sanki
- Birbirini tanırcasına kucaklaştı.
- They hugged as if they knew each other.
- Beni hiç görmemişçesine baktılar.
- They looked at me as if they had never seen me before.
Usage notes
- This suffix may be added to a verb in any of the following tenses: aorist, continuous, inferential (even when added to another tense suffix, eg.: gülüyormuşçasına, “as if X had been laughing”), and future.
